What is the Bank of Ireland Business Account Application?

The Bank of Ireland Business Account Application serves as a formal means for various business entities to access essential banking services. This application is crucial for sole traders, partnerships, and limited companies in Ireland seeking to streamline their business banking operations. By completing this application, businesses can manage their finances more effectively while enhancing their professional image with clients and suppliers.

Purpose and Benefits of the Bank of Ireland Business Account Application

Completing the Bank of Ireland Business Account Application offers significant advantages for businesses. Firstly, applicants gain access to a range of tailored business banking services that align with their specific business structure. A dedicated business account simplifies financial management, allowing businesses to track expenses and income clearly.
Moreover, having a professional banking setup enhances credibility and instills trust with clients and suppliers, thereby supporting business growth and stability.

Who Needs the Bank of Ireland Business Account Application?

The Bank of Ireland Business Account Application is essential for various business types. Sole traders, partnerships, and limited companies should consider applying when they reach a stage where professional banking services are required. For instance, sole traders may need a business account to keep personal and business finances separate, while limited companies often need one to meet legal and financial requirements.
Those who frequently deal with larger transactions or multiple clients may also benefit significantly from a dedicated business account.

Eligibility Criteria for the Bank of Ireland Business Account Application

To successfully submit the Bank of Ireland Business Account Application, businesses must meet specific eligibility criteria. Different business types—sole traders, partnerships, and limited companies—have unique requirements that must be fulfilled. Generally, applicants should be registered in Ireland and provide relevant business identification.
It's important to consider any jurisdictional factors that may apply and ensure compliance with local regulations to facilitate a smooth application process.

Required Documentation and Supporting Materials

Applicants must provide thorough and accurate documentation to support their applications. Necessary documents typically include:
  • Bank statements
  • Certificates of incorporation
  • Identification documents
Gathering these materials before completing the application is advisable to increase efficiency and ensure the application's success.

How to Sign the Bank of Ireland Business Account Application

Signing the Bank of Ireland Business Account Application can be completed through various methods. Depending on the application process, you may require either a digital or a wet signature. If opting for an electronic signature, tools like pdfFiller can facilitate the eSigning process, allowing all signatories to complete their sections seamlessly.
Ensure that every required signatory fulfills their obligations to avoid processing delays.

Submission Methods for the Bank of Ireland Business Account Application

After completing the application, users have multiple submission options. You can choose to submit online, in person, or by post, depending on your preference and convenience. It is essential to consult the contact details provided on the Bank of Ireland's website for submission locations and relevant information regarding processing times and next steps.
